Micro, Small, and Medium Enterprises (MSMEs) play a crucial role in driving the local economy, yet many still struggle with effective financial management due to a lack of basic bookkeeping skills. This community service activity (PKM), titled "Simple Bookkeeping to Improve the Efficiency and Effectiveness of Financial Management for UMKM Jawara Bojongsari", aimed to address these challenges by equipping MSME actors with practical knowledge of simple financial recording methods. The program was conducted in April 2025 in Bojongsari Subdistrict, Depok City, and involved 15 lecturers from Universitas Pamulang as facilitators. A total of 25 MSME participants from the Jawara (Jaringan Wirausaha) Bojongsari network took part in the training. The implementation methods included material presentations, hands-on practice, group discussions, and Q&A sessions. As a result, participants gained a better understanding of financial recording practices such as income and expense tracking, ledger preparation, and basic financial planning. The activity significantly increased participants' financial awareness and confidence in managing their businesses. This PKM program demonstrated that structured and practical financial education can contribute positively to improving the financial literacy and operational efficiency of local MSMEs.
